Deluxe Suite-Sur-Lac Superieur - Tremblant Versant Nord
46.20656, -74.47475Offering a swimming pool, the spacious 66 m² Deluxe Suite - View On Lake & 6 Min From Tremblant Versant Nord is situated about 10 minutes' drive from Mont Nixon. Duncan Express is located about 10 minutes' drive from the 1-bedroom apartment.
Location
A 5-minute walk will take you to the city centre.
The nearest airport is La Macaza - Mont Tremblant International set 80 km away.
Rooms
Deluxe Suite - View On Lake & 6 Min From Tremblant Versant Nord features a stone fireplace and sound-proofed windows, comforts like ironing facilities and an air conditioner, as well as a TV. The accommodation is also furnished with a sofa and a work desk. Beds fitted with hypo-allergenic pillows are at guests' disposal. For added convenience, a walk-in shower, a separate toilet, and a bath are available at the apartment. Moreover, there are hair dryers and bath sheets as well.
Eat & Drink
The self-catering facilities feature an equipped kitchen with a microwave, an electric kettle, and a fridge.
Leisure & Business
This apartment entices guests with an aqua park and a golf course, along with options for staying fit such as fitness classes. Access to a spa lounge provides an additional opportunity for relaxation. If sport sounds tempting, canoeing, hiking, and ping-pong are offered.
